FULTON, NY – Earl Hofmann, 86, of Granby, died Saturday February 10, 2018, in Oswego Hospital.

He was born in Newark, NJ, the son of the late Julius and Grace (Pealo) Hofmann.

He was a land developer, developing Hofmann Heights on Germandale Drive in Granby, and a farmer where he was the recipient of the prestigious farming award, the Oswego County Top Dairy Producer, he also worked as truck driver for Container Corp. of Fulton.

Mr. Hofmann was predeceased by his twin children, Julius and Jolene Hofmann.

He is survived by his wife of 67 years, Eleanor (Duger) Hofmann of Granby; and children, Lynn (Greg) Waloven of Hannibal, Rosemary (David) Emmons of Hannibal, Earl Dan Hofmann of Fulton, Patricia (Marc) Marino of Fulton, Tammy Brown of Fulton, and Shelley (Martin) Tomasino of Fulton, adopted son, Heraldo (Barbara) Reyes; 16 grandchildren; and 29 great-grandchildren.

Memorial service will be conducted Tuesday 6 p.m. at the Bowens Corner Methodist Church.

Burial will be private.

There will be no calling hours.

The arrangements are in the care of the Sugar Funeral Home Inc. 224 W. Second St S., Fulton.

The family has requested contributions may be made to Bowens Corner Methodist Church, 758 State Route 176, Fulton, or the Oswego County SPCA.
